#e93f02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e93f02 is composed of 91.4% red, 24.7%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 15.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#e93f02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7e04 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#e93f02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e93f02 has RGB values of R:233, G:63,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.99,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15286018.

Shades and Tints of #e93f02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130500 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e93f02
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d726e is the less saturated color, while #e93f02 is the most saturated one.
